Garage door rollers are small but important components that permit your door to move up and down easily. They sometimes fit into tracks and are designed to deal with appreciable weight. Here are a few key points:

Gathering the Necessary Tools and Materials
Before starting, be sure to have everything you need. This will save time and ensure an environment friendly replacement course of:
- New garage door rollers Screwdriver or nut driver Wrench set Safety goggles and gloves Ladder (if necessary)

Removing the Old Rollers
With the door secured, you probably can begin the elimination of the old rollers:
- Use a screwdriver to remove the track stop (the element that holds the rollers in place). Carefully pull the old rollers out of the track. Installing the New Garage Door Rollers
Now it's time to install the brand new rollers, guaranteeing they're fitted http://spencerfdxr322.trexgame.net/20-questions-you-should-always-ask-about-before-buying-it-3 accurately for optimum efficiency:
- Insert the new rollers into the track. Make certain they roll freely and easily. Reattach the track stop utilizing a screwdriver. Open and close the garage door manually to make sure every little thing is working nicely before reconnecting the opener.
Testing the Garage Door Functionality
Once the new rollers are put in, it's essential to test the garage door to verify it's operating as it should:
- Reattach the garage door opener to the door. Test the door’s balance by manually lifting it about halfway and letting go. It should keep in place. Operate the opener to ensure it smoothly strikes the door with none unusual noises.
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Now that you’ve changed the rollers, contemplate these maintenance tricks to extend their lifespan:
- Regularly lubricate the rollers and the tracks with a garage door lubricant. Check for particles and clear the tracks as needed, especially in areas around Encino and Northridge. Perform annual inspections to catch any issues before they require repairs.
